SoapServerMessage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Représente les données d’une requête SOAP reçue ou d’une réponse SOAP envoyée par une méthode de service Web XML à un niveau spécifique SoapMessageStage. Cette classe ne peut pas être héritée.
public ref class SoapServerMessage sealed : System::Web::Services::Protocols::SoapMessage
public sealed class SoapServerMessage : System.Web.Services.Protocols.SoapMessage
type SoapServerMessage = class
inherit SoapMessage
Public NotInheritable Class SoapServerMessage
Inherits SoapMessage
- Héritage
Exemples
Le fragment de code suivant fait partie d’une extension SOAP qui enregistre les messages SOAP envoyés et reçus par une méthode de service Web XML. Ce fragment spécifique traite la SoapServerMessage méthode de l’extension SOAP en SoapExtension.ProcessMessage écrivant des propriétés du SoapServerMessage fichier journal.
Propriétés
| Nom | Description |
|---|---|
| Action |
Obtient le champ d’en-tête de requête HTTP SOAPAction pour la requête SOAP ou la réponse SOAP. |
| ContentEncoding |
Obtient ou définit le contenu de l’en-tête |
| ContentType |
Obtient ou définit le protocole HTTP |
| Exception |
Obtient l’appel SoapException à la méthode de service Web XML. (Hérité de SoapMessage) |
| Headers |
Collection des en-têtes SOAP appliqués à la requête SOAP ou à la réponse SOAP actuelle. (Hérité de SoapMessage) |
| MethodInfo |
Obtient une représentation du prototype de méthode pour la méthode de service Web XML pour laquelle la requête SOAP est destinée. |
| OneWay |
Obtient une valeur indiquant si le client attend que le serveur termine le traitement d’une méthode de service Web XML. |
| Server |
Obtient l’instance de la classe qui gère l’appel de méthode sur le serveur Web. |
| SoapVersion |
Obtient la version du protocole SOAP utilisé pour communiquer avec le service Web XML. |
| Stage |
Obtient le SoapMessageStageSoapMessage. (Hérité de SoapMessage) |
| Stream |
Obtient les données représentant la requête SOAP ou la réponse SOAP sous la forme d’un Stream. (Hérité de SoapMessage) |
| Url |
Obtient l’URL de base du service Web XML. |
Méthodes
| Nom | Description |
|---|---|
| EnsureInStage() |
En cas de substitution dans une classe dérivée, affirme que le courant SoapMessageStage est une étape où les paramètres sont disponibles. (Hérité de SoapMessage) |
| EnsureOutStage() |
En cas de substitution dans une classe dérivée, affirme que l’étape actuelle SoapMessageStage est une étape où les paramètres de sortie sont disponibles. (Hérité de SoapMessage) |
| EnsureStage(SoapMessageStage) |
Garantit que l’appel SoapMessageStage à la méthode de service Web XML est l’étape ou les étapes passées. Si l’étape de traitement actuelle n’est pas l’une des étapes passées, une exception est levée. (Hérité de SoapMessage) |
| Equals(Object) |
Détermine si l’objet spécifié est égal à l’objet actuel. (Hérité de Object) |
| GetHashCode() |
Sert de fonction de hachage par défaut. (Hérité de Object) |
| GetInParameterValue(Int32) |
Obtient le paramètre passé dans la méthode de service Web XML à l’index spécifié. (Hérité de SoapMessage) |
| GetOutParameterValue(Int32) |
Obtient le paramètre out passé dans la méthode de service Web XML à l’index spécifié. (Hérité de SoapMessage) |
| GetReturnValue() |
Obtient la valeur de retour d’une méthode de service Web XML. (Hérité de SoapMessage) |
| GetType() |
Obtient la Type de l’instance actuelle. (Hérité de Object) |
| MemberwiseClone() |
Crée une copie superficielle du Objectactuel. (Hérité de Object) |
| ToString() |
Retourne une chaîne qui représente l’objet actuel. (Hérité de Object) |